[2759] | 1 | module drstemplates |
---|
| 2 | !$$$ SUBPROGRAM DOCUMENTATION BLOCK |
---|
| 3 | ! . . . . |
---|
| 4 | ! MODULE: drstemplates |
---|
| 5 | ! PRGMMR: Gilbert ORG: W/NP11 DATE: 2001-04-03 |
---|
| 6 | ! |
---|
| 7 | ! ABSTRACT: This Fortran Module contains info on all the available |
---|
| 8 | ! GRIB2 Data Representation Templates used in Section 5 (DRS). |
---|
| 9 | ! Each Template has three parts: The number of entries in the template |
---|
| 10 | ! (mapgridlen); A map of the template (mapgrid), which contains the |
---|
| 11 | ! number of octets in which to pack each of the template values; and |
---|
| 12 | ! a logical value (needext) that indicates whether the Template needs |
---|
| 13 | ! to be extended. In some cases the number of entries in a template |
---|
| 14 | ! can vary depending upon values specified in the "static" part of |
---|
| 15 | ! the template. ( See Template 5.1 as an example ) |
---|
| 16 | ! |
---|
| 17 | ! This module also contains two subroutines. Subroutine getdrstemplate |
---|
| 18 | ! returns the octet map for a specified Template number, and |
---|
| 19 | ! subroutine extdrstemplate will calculate the extended octet map |
---|
| 20 | ! of an appropriate template given values for the "static" part of the |
---|
| 21 | ! template. See docblocks below for the arguments and usage of these |
---|
| 22 | ! routines. |
---|
| 23 | ! |
---|
| 24 | ! NOTE: Array mapgrid contains the number of octets in which the |
---|
| 25 | ! corresponding template values will be stored. A negative value in |
---|
| 26 | ! mapgrid is used to indicate that the corresponding template entry can |
---|
| 27 | ! contain negative values. This information is used later when packing |
---|
| 28 | ! (or unpacking) the template data values. Negative data values in GRIB |
---|
| 29 | ! are stored with the left most bit set to one, and a negative number |
---|
| 30 | ! of octets value in mapgrid() indicates that this possibility should |
---|
| 31 | ! be considered. The number of octets used to store the data value |
---|
| 32 | ! in this case would be the absolute value of the negative value in |
---|
| 33 | ! mapgrid(). |
---|
